Is it OK to take levothyroxine and liothyronine together? Levothyroxine and liothyronine are two different thyroid hormones. Levothyroxine is the synthetic form of the thyroid hormone thyroxine, while liothyronine is the synthetic form of triiodothyronine. Both levothyroxine and liothyronine are used to treat hypothyroidism.
